// SPDX-License-Identifier: Apache-2.0
// SPDX-FileCopyrightText: Copyright The LanceDB Authors
use pyo3::prelude::*;
use pyo3::types::PyDict;
use std::collections::HashMap;
/// A wrapper around a Python HeaderProvider that can be called from Rust
pub struct PyHeaderProvider {
provider: Py<PyAny>,
}
impl Clone for PyHeaderProvider {
fn clone(&self) -> Self {
Python::attach(|py| Self {
provider: self.provider.clone_ref(py),
})
}
}
impl PyHeaderProvider {
pub fn new(provider: Py<PyAny>) -> Self {
Self { provider }
}
/// Get headers from the Python provider (internal implementation)
fn get_headers_internal(&self) -> Result<HashMap<String, String>, String> {
Python::attach(|py| {
// Call the get_headers method
let result = self.provider.call_method0(py, "get_headers");
match result {
Ok(headers_py) => {
// Convert Python dict to Rust HashMap
let bound_headers = headers_py.bind(py);
let dict: &Bound<PyDict> = bound_headers.downcast().map_err(|e| {
format!("HeaderProvider.get_headers must return a dict: {}", e)
})?;
let mut headers = HashMap::new();
for (key, value) in dict {
let key_str: String = key
.extract()
.map_err(|e| format!("Header key must be string: {}", e))?;
let value_str: String = value
.extract()
.map_err(|e| format!("Header value must be string: {}", e))?;
headers.insert(key_str, value_str);
}
Ok(headers)
}
Err(e) => Err(format!("Failed to get headers from provider: {}", e)),
}
})
}
}
#[cfg(feature = "remote")]
#[async_trait::async_trait]
impl lancedb::remote::HeaderProvider for PyHeaderProvider {
async fn get_headers(&self) -> lancedb::error::Result<HashMap<String, String>> {
self.get_headers_internal()
.map_err(|e| lancedb::Error::Runtime { message: e })
}
}
impl std::fmt::Debug for PyHeaderProvider {
fn fmt(&self, f: &mut std::fmt::Formatter<'_>) -> std::fmt::Result {
write!(f, "PyHeaderProvider")
}
}
